Highlights
Iberdrola is a Spanish utility company. The company is engaged primarily in the generation, transmission, distribution, and marketing of electricity and natural gas.
Iberdrola acquired international energy company ScottishPower in November 2006, giving access to new markets and augmenting its generation capability along with other benefits. The combined entity operates in Spain, the UK, the US, Mexico, Brazil, Greece, Portugal, France, Germany, Italy, Poland, Guatemala, Bolivia, and Chile.
Iberdrola is engaged in hydroelectric and non-renewable energy generation in Spain, with a total generation capacity of 30,384 megawatts (MW) from natural gas, nuclear, coal, fuel-oil, and cogeneration facilities. With the acquisition of ScottishPower, the capacity has increased to 40,000 MW. The company produces electricity from renewable sources.
